Off-Road and Larger Tire Options for GMC C2500 Suburban

The GMC C2500 Suburban is a robust truck that benefits greatly from aftermarket larger tires and specialized off-road tread designs. We carry top off-road tire brands like Toyo, BF Goodrich, Nitto, and Cooper that offer excellent traction and durability on rugged terrain. These tires enhance your Suburban’s capability for mud, rocks, and uneven trails while maintaining on-road comfort.

Explore popular off-road tire models such as the BF Goodrich ALL-TERRAIN T/A KO2 or the Toyo OPEN COUNTRY A/T for proven performance. For those seeking even more aggressive tread patterns, the Nitto TRAIL GRAPPLER M/T is a great choice.

Tire Size and Performance Considerations

Choosing the right tire size is essential for fitment and performance on your GMC C2500 Suburban. Common sizes include 265/75-16, which provide a balance between clearance and ride quality. Larger tires may require modifications but can significantly improve off-road capability and aesthetics.

It's generally recommended to replace tires in pairs or all four on a GMC C2500 Suburban to maintain balanced handling and traction, especially for off-road or 4WD use. Replacing one tire can cause uneven tread wear and affect vehicle stability. Learn more and schedule your tire service at schedule an appointment.
